Clipping (morphology) In linguistics, clipping, also called truncation or shortening, [1] is word formation by removing some segments of an existing word to create a diminutive word or a clipped compound. Middle clipping Middle clipping involves keeping the central segment of the word: Examples: flu = influenza fridge = refrigerator Complex clipping Complex Clipping In complex clipping, words within compounds undergo abbreviation.
